iPhone App - Multi-Client IM App

Palringo is the first official multi-client IM (instant messenger) application for the iPhone.  The program supports Google Talk/Jabber, Windows Live Messenger, Yahoo, ICQ, iChat, and Gadu-Gadu.
I just got done installing it… it takes a a bit to figure it out… but seems to work well once you get the settings right.
